Top Three Things We Learned and Did Today:
  • In gym, we started the lacrosse unit.  We practiced throwing and catching with a net, as well as scooping the ball from the ground.  If you would like to bring your own lacrosse stick from home you can.
  • Today in math, we reviewed how to properly use a ruler to measure different objects and lengths.
  • In art, we went outside and learned about perspective.  If things are closer you draw them bigger, if they are farther away you draw them smaller.  We also learned how to overlap drawings and about the horizon line.  We then practiced all these new concepts by drawing a landscape in the Whispering Woods and the amphitheater.
